Deacon s Thoughts Merciful Like the Father Which of the 3 main characters are we in the parable of today s Gospel of the Prodigal Son (Luke 15:1-32)? The father, son or older brother? There are times in our life journey that I think we have been each one of those persons. Are we the son that is lost, just like the lost sheep, the older son that doesn t appreciate and understand that the father is with him always or the merciful, forgiving and welcoming father? From this story today we should feel the overwhelming power of the mercy of God, who withholds no affection for those who have walked a crooked path or have been lost. God s mercy and forgiveness should touch, console and give us hope. Jesus wants us to know in a special way, that even after we have made stupid mistakes and sinned, He is there looking for us and with open arms wanting to take us back to Him. He is looking to restore us to His love, because God is tireless in seeking out sinners. It is comforting to know that should we, for some reason stray or become lost, our loving Father is joyfully there waiting for us. In our world today, in our Church today, we can see the signs, whereby there are a lot of souls, people who are adrift morally and spiritually and in need of so much healing. Just like the prodigal son, many have scattered, walked away from God and are leading a life of sin and are on the hard path of life. They have been misled by the world, confused and disoriented in their troubles and do not understand or are experiencing God as a loving Father. We must focus on the father, who is telling us something special about God our Father. We are in a family relationship with God whose kindness is beyond words that we can t describe. He welcomes his rebellious children home and treats them as if they never left. The battle of lost souls will not be won, but we have to do our part and not be like the older son who did not understand the pain and loss of the father or joy of the reunion. God expects His love and forgiveness to be imitated by us. How else can He seek the lost and scattered and save them except through us? His pardon is brought into this world by the love and mercy we show to others. Blessed Mother Theresa is a perfect example of one who spread love, compassion and mercy around the world. We may not be called to the same vocation and ministry as Saint Mother Teresa, but we are called to look past the doors of our Church and spread God s love, compassion and mercy. By doing so we welcome home the lost which shows how much we value and treasure our relationship with God. Remember that God s mercy is a gift to us and what we receive from Him we must pass on to others around us. Deacon Gino Scripture Meditation "The Pharisees and scribes began to complain, saying, 'This man welcomes sinners and eats with them.'" Jesus knew these self-righteous religious leaders were complaining. And he knew they needed to learn a lesson. So, in addition to giving a lived example of welcoming the company of "tax collectors and sinners," Jesus also directly taught the skeptics about the importance of welcoming those who have been lost. Today's Gospel gives a powerhouse lineup of three parables that all teach a similar message: rejoice over the lost sheep, rejoice over the lost coin, and rejoice over the return of the lost son. The theme can be summarized in the simple directive: rejoice don't reject. When someone who isn't part of the "fold" appears in church, this is cause for rejoicing! It should not be cause for gossip, sideways glances, or nervous whispers about what to do or say. Rather a genuine smile and word of welcome would be in order at the very least, and a heartfelt invitation to join the community would be totally appropriate. Too often we become complacent about our Christian company. We get used to seeing the same people every Sunday and forget about the "lost" men and women who are outside the bounds of our comfort zone. Jesus gives us the image of an active shepherd who goes "after the lost one until he finds it," and a diligent widow who will "sweep the house, searching carefully" until she finds her coin. He tells us of a father who "ran to his son, embraced and kissed him," in spite of the separation they had faced. We too are called to take initiative in seeking out those who are lost, and to rejoice heartily when they finally do come back home.
